Get it from crutchfield, or an authorized dealer! ebay stores say they give you a warranty but ITS NOT TRUE! manufacturers only redeem warranties when they are purchased through an authorized retailer which ebay is not! Dont be cheap, I've learned that being cheap will cost you more in the end... so save up a little more and get a warranty with your purchase!
